Inclusion Criteria: The Yale Brown score 20 or more; Age 20 to 60 years; Medication with Fluoxetine; Having at least primary education
Exclusion criteria: Lack of cooperation during study despite adequate explanation; Having heart disease; Having neurological disease; Medication except Fluoxetine; Use of benzodiazepines and other antihistamines; ECT in the past two months; Existence of electronic devices and metal in the body; Exacerbation of disease and suicidal thoughts; Pregnancy; Having other psychiatric disorders; Having physical disease; Mental retardation; History of drug and alcohol abuse
